The intubation head typically consists of various components that aid in the insertion and placement of the endotracheal tube. These components include the laryngoscope, endotracheal tube, stylet, and other necessary tools. The laryngoscope is used to lift the patient’s tongue and jaw to visualize the vocal cords and guide the placement of the endotracheal tube into the trachea. The endotracheal tube is then passed through the vocal cords and into the trachea to establish a secure airway.

One of the key reasons for intubation head is to provide mechanical ventilation to patients who are unable to breathe adequately on their own. This may be due to various medical conditions such as trauma, respiratory failure, or unconsciousness. By securing an airway through intubation, healthcare providers can deliver oxygen and remove carbon dioxide from the patient’s lungs, thereby supporting respiratory function and ensuring adequate oxygenation of the body’s tissues.
intubation head is also commonly performed during surgeries to maintain a patent airway and enable the administration of anesthetic agents. It allows for precise control of the patient’s breathing and prevents any obstruction that may arise during the procedure. Additionally, intubation head enables healthcare providers to suction respiratory secretions, deliver medications, and monitor the patient’s breathing and oxygen levels throughout the surgery.
While intubation head is a life-saving procedure, it is not without risks and complications. Improper placement of the endotracheal tube can result in inadequate oxygenation, aspiration of stomach contents, or damage to the vocal cords and trachea. Patients who undergo intubation may also experience discomfort, sore throat, hoarseness, or dental injury as a result of the procedure. Healthcare providers must be vigilant in monitoring the patient’s vital signs and respiratory status following intubation to detect and address any complications promptly.
In recent years, advancements in technology have led to the development of specialized tools and techniques to improve the success rate and safety of intubation head. Video laryngoscopes, flexible bronchoscopes, and airway management devices have been introduced to enhance visualization of the airway and facilitate the insertion of the endotracheal tube. These advancements have helped to reduce the risk of complications and improve patient outcomes during intubation procedures.
